Working together on documents has become more and more important in the last two years and therefore we present here three different ways on how this works on the platforms of the University of Hamburg.
On AGORA, the real-time editor "Etherpad" can be used for collaborative work. The authors are assigned different colours when they type. This makes it easy to distinguish the contributions from each other. There is also a chat function and the possibility to access the version history. Etherpad can be activated optionally and is only available in the material rubric.

OnlyOffice is available on the OpenOlat platform for collaborative work. This is a document editor that allows several people to work synchronously on one document, chat or comment. With OnlyOffice, Word, Excel and PowerPoint files can be created and edited. OpenDocument files can also be created. The editor is available in the course in the rubrics "Document", "Folder", "Groups", " Group Task" and "Task".

If you prefer to work platform-independently, HedgeDoc, also called UHH-Pad, is a good choice. This is an online editor that can be used very intuitively. It can be used for plain text entry, but can also be used in a more complex way through Markdown. It is also possible to integrate external Markdown resources. The default setting is a double window, but a presentation mode can be selected and it is also possible to publish. This editor can also be incorporated into an OpenOlat course.
